Chris Carruthers - International Career

International Career

He represented the England national under-20 team over a period of two years, first being called into the squad for a game against Switzerland in November 2002. Carruthers made his debut in this game, starting in a 2–0 defeat at home on 12 December. He played at the 2003 Toulon Tournament, marking Cristiano Ronaldo when the team played Portugal, with Carruthers saying in retrospect "I did okay against him though." He started in all four of England's game in the tournament, which they were knocked out of following a 1–0 defeat to Japan. He was named in the squad for a friendly against the Czech Republic on 9 October 2003 and he entered the game as a half-time substitute before being forced to leave after around 60 minutes due to an injury. He was selected in the squad for the 2003 FIFA World Youth Championship and he played in two of England's three games at the tournament. He earned 11 caps for the team.
